Aurelia's Stellar Odyssey: A Radiant Tale of Cosmic Struggle
Summary
Aurelia Starshade and the Eclipse of Endless Night unfolds as young Aurelia discovers her fateful connection to the stars. As the celestial order unravels under the malevolent influence of Silvarax, she embarks on a perilous journey through ethereal battlefields and the very Loom of Fate to restore balance and prevent eternal darkness.
Analysis
Counting Sheep crafts a mesmerizing tale that seamlessly blends mythology, fantasy, and the wonder of the cosmos. The narrative is rich with vivid imagery and profound themes, making for an enchanting read.
The story opens with Aurelia perceiving subtle disturbances in the night sky, hinting at deeper cosmic troubles. This subtle start gradually builds tension as she uncovers the sinister plot orchestrated by Silvarax.
"The stars were breathing." This poetic opening line immediately immerses readers in the magical realism permeating the world. It sets the stage for Aurelia's unique connection to the celestial bodies.
As Aurelia ventures into the Starfire Plains, the descriptions of the battle between light and darkness are both harrowing and beautiful. "Starborn Warriors, brighter and larger than life, surged across the plain, their armor cracked and flickering, their weapons formed of trailing, crystalline light." These visuals create a vivid sense of scale and the high-stakes nature of the conflict.
The introduction of the Twilight Fox adds an element of mystery and propels Aurelia's character growth. Through facing illusions and her own fears, Aurelia demonstrates resilience and determination, qualities essential for her ultimate confrontation.
At the Loom of Celestial Fate, the narrative reaches a philosophical peak, exploring free will versus destiny. "Part of you was born from the sun's promise," the Weaver reveals, "But part from longing for the dark." This duality in Aurelia's nature adds depth to her character and her pivotal role in shaping the future.
The climax, where Aurelia confronts Silvarax, is emotionally charged. Her declaration, "I am written by longing and hope both. That's why you can't win," encapsulates her growth and the story's central theme: the power of hope amidst darkness.
